#46 7 years ago

You can also tell original playfields by "makers mark" date edge stamps in the front edge, and sometimes tied or stapled tags, no NOS Fathom playfield was clear coated (all were lacquered) unless aftermarket processed, and small variations in inserts, color and scripts, among other factors, such as ink screening colors. This is really a separate topic.

A 30+ year old games inserts are slightly color aged, unless in absolutely outstanding climate controlled conditions in a vacuum, due to air exposure of plastic, even if stored in a crate. Date stamps and inspections can be faked, but rarely done.
